If we observe the structure of proteins, disulphide bonds are formed between 

a
Cystine residues that are close together
b
Proline residues that are close together
c
Histidine residues that are close together
d
Methionine residues present in close proximity

detailed solution

Correct option is A

in a protein disulphide bonds are formed between cysteine residues present nearer or slightly far way in a polypeptide chain or in between polypeptide chain. These bonds play a role in the tertiary structure of a protein.
